The position

As an HR Business Partner, you provide HR support to the organisation (market or combination of functional groups in market). You coach our leaders and the leadership team and provide expertise in the development and support of the organisational talent and diversity strategy, workforce planning, organisational design. Change management, leader effectiveness, performance management, compensation and rewards and labor & employee relations issues are also part of your job.

To broaden your skills you will either participate in or lead HR related projects regarding local initiatives or translate global initiatives to the local market needs/ practice.

Welcome to our team

The HR organisation for The Netherlands is a small, but effective team that consists of the HR Director, 3 HR Business Partners, a Compensation & Benefits Lead, Health Coordinator and HR Support. Next to that the HR organisation is extended by the Global Payroll, HR Service Delivery and Global Talent Attraction (Recruitment) organisation. The one HR organisation supports both the manufacturing site in Oss (around 1200 employees) and our office in Amsterdam (around 100 employees).
